Drivers should provide 2 proofs of residence in the state of New York in order to be qualified for a REAL ID or an Enhanced Driver's License. Proof of home can consist of a current utility costs, bank statement, pay stub, or charge card costs with your present address on it. Any files which contain a P.O. Box can not be accepted. Once you have the right documentation, you must visit your regional DMV workplace and send them. The DMV will then process your application and problem you a short-term file up until your official document shows up in the mail. You can likewise pre-screen your application and documents online before a trip to the DMV, which enhances your in-person check out and decreases processing time. Time frame If you're a new driver in the state of New York, you'll have to follow specific steps in order to get your license. This includes taking a series of tests and logging a minimum of 50 hours of practice driving. You'll also need to offer proof of identity and residency. As soon as you've successfully passed all of the needed tests and finished all other requirements, you'll receive your complete New York drivers license in the mail. The primary step in the New York driver's license process is obtaining a learners permit. To do this, you'll need to visit your local DMV workplace and pass a composed test. You'll also require to finish a five-hour pre-licensing course. You can take this course at home or online, and it will cover defensive driving methods and traffic laws. You'll then need to spend a minimum of 6 months with a permit before arranging your roadway test. In this time, you'll require to log a minimum of 50 behind-the-wheel hours under the supervision of a parent/guardian or certified driver over 21 years of ages. Of these, 15 hours need to be at night and 10 hours should be in moderate to rush hour. Once you've logged these hours, it's time to arrange your roadway test. After you've successfully passed your roadway test, you'll get your full New York driver's license in the mail. Most of the times, your license will benefit eight years.
